Output 95ec2cefc64255bc3895c730cadd9a514787bf1971fae223fa41b6c7f423b628:0

value
743293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cd393f8de406086e9c23e6272b53291b57d506c OP_EQUAL
address
3D53B2dqvpHGdUJxHQjVCQoR36L4HJxFcN
transaction
95ec2cefc64255bc3895c730cadd9a514787bf1971fae223fa41b6c7f423b628
spent
true